New Directions is a social service agency offering a wide range of resources and services that foster people's hopes and dreams and their community.


Child Home Services (CHS) is one of the many programs offered by New Directions; this program provides homes for children and youth with behavioral and emotional difficulties. Our community-based resources are designed to promote a sense of belonging and provide opportunities to engage in a meaningful life. This is achieved by creating a home environment that welcomes the participation of the child or youth as a member, supporting his or her pursuit of interests and goals, and helping maintain and strengthen the bond between the child or youth and his or her significant others. We provide an environment that is non-judgmental, safe and caring.

If you have a passion for supporting children & youth in the community you will:

  • Establish meaningful, caring, and respectful relationships with children and youth
  • Provide medical, emotional, environmental, physical and behavioural support
  • Participate in programming to meet the individual goals of children and youth
  • Accompany children & youth to activities and appointments such as grocery shopping, medical appointments, community events and home maintenance
  • Provide assistance with personal care routines such as lifts, transfers, personal hygiene, and nutrition support
  • Complete all required documentation effectively
  • Liaise with the education system and other community resources

Points to consider:

  • This home is located in the Tyndall Park/North Winnipeg area. Access to reliable bus service is unpredictable on evenings and weekends so it is preferred that applicants have access to reliable transportation
  • This role is physically demanding. Health Care Aide training and experience is considered an asset
  • The individuals in this home may display physical behaviours of concern, so it is important for staff to have a good understanding of the support plan and to communicate effectively as a team
  • New Directions is dedicated to the ongoing learning and development of our employees. You will be expected to engage in the orientation and training opportunities provided to you on your employment journey
  • Fluency in American Sign Language (ASL) is considered an asset

Requirements:

  • A High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Valid driver's license, and access to a reliable vehicle
  • 2 years of directly related education and/or experience supporting individuals with autism, intellectual/developmental disabilities, mental health issues, anxiety, selfinjurious behaviour/suicidal ideation, FASD, behavioural problems and emotional difficulties is considered an asset
  • Ability to transfer knowledge and awareness into behaviors and expectations recognized as appropriate by members of identified cultures and by people with lived experience
  • Effective selfcare strategies and ability to remain professional in stressful situations
  • First Aid /C.P.R., and Nonviolent Crisis Intervention Training (NCI) certification are considered assets.


The salary range for this 32-hour bi-weekly position is $15.89 to $22.25 per hour (equivalent to $13,220 to $18.512 per annum), dependent upon education and/or experience.
